In the ever-evolving digital landscape, marketing agencies face the critical challenge of ensuring their clients’ websites are both secure and performant. As a WordPress developer, understanding how to maximize WordPress security and performance can significantly influence your clients’ trust and their overall success. The implications of security breaches or slow-loading sites can be detrimental, resulting in lost revenue and damaged reputation. By implementing expert development solutions, you not only enhance the functionality of the websites you manage but also bolster the credibility of your agency. This article explores the best practices and technical strategies that junior developers can utilize to deliver outstanding results for their clients.
Understanding the Importance of WordPress Security
WordPress is the most popular content management system in the world, powering over 40% of all websites. This popularity makes it a prominent target for cyberattacks. Agencies must prioritize security as part of their service offerings to prevent unauthorized access and data breaches. Here are some of the key reasons why security should be a top priority:
- Client Trust: A secure site fosters trust among clients and visitors, leading to higher conversion rates.
- Data Protection: Protecting sensitive information is essential for maintaining compliance with regulations such as GDPR.
- Reputation Management: Security breaches can lead to negative publicity and loss of credibility.
Implementing robust security measures not only protects your clients’ interests but also enhances your agency’s reputation as a reliable service provider. The following sections will delve into specific strategies and tools to maximize WordPress security effectively.
Implementing Essential Security Measures
To maximize WordPress security, agencies should adopt a multi-layered approach. This includes the following essential security measures:
1. Regular Updates
Keeping WordPress core, themes, and plugins updated is critical. Outdated software is one of the most common vulnerabilities.
- Log in to the WordPress admin panel.
- Navigate to Dashboard > Updates.
- Select all available updates and click Update Plugins/Themes.
2. Strong Password Policies
Enforce strong password policies for all users. Utilize tools like WP Password Policy Manager to implement complexity requirements.
3. Two-Factor Authentication (2FA)
Implementing 2FA adds an additional layer of security. Consider using plugins like Google Authenticator for easy setup.
4. Regular Security Audits
Conducting regular security audits helps identify vulnerabilities. Utilize tools like WPScan to scan for known vulnerabilities in plugins and themes.
By integrating these measures into your workflow, you can create a secure foundation for your clients’ websites, minimizing the risk of security incidents.
Enhancing Performance for Optimal User Experience
A fast-loading website is crucial for retaining visitors and enhancing user experience. Performance optimization not only impacts SEO but also directly correlates with conversion rates. Here are several strategies to enhance WordPress performance:
1. Caching Solutions
Implement caching solutions to reduce server load and improve load times. Popular caching plugins include:
2. Image Optimization
Large images can slow down your site significantly. Use plugins like Smush or ShortPixel to optimize images without losing quality.
3. Minification of CSS and JavaScript
Minifying CSS and JavaScript files can reduce the file size and improve loading times. Use plugins such as Autoptimize for effective minification.
4. Content Delivery Network (CDN)
Utilizing a CDN can distribute the load, resulting in faster delivery of content to users worldwide. Popular CDNs include:
These optimization strategies will not only enhance website speed but also improve the overall user experience, which is essential for maintaining client satisfaction.
Monitoring Performance and Security Metrics
To ensure that your security and performance measures are effective, it’s crucial to monitor relevant metrics consistently. Here are some key performance and security metrics to track:
1. Load Time
Use tools like Google PageSpeed Insights or GTmetrix to assess load times and identify areas for improvement.
2. Uptime Monitoring
Tools like Uptime Robot can help monitor website uptime, ensuring that your clients’ sites are always accessible.
3. Security Incidents
Track security incidents and vulnerabilities using plugins that offer logging and reporting features. Regularly review these logs to address issues proactively.
4. User Engagement
Analyze user engagement metrics such as bounce rate and session duration using tools like Google Analytics.
By continuously monitoring these metrics, agencies can ensure that their security and performance measures are not just implemented but are also effective in driving business results.
Step-by-Step Guide to Implementing a Security and Performance Checklist
To streamline the implementation of security and performance measures, follow this step-by-step checklist:
- Backup Your Site: Use plugins like UpdraftPlus to create regular backups.
- Update Core, Themes, and Plugins: Regularly check for updates in the admin dashboard and apply them promptly.
- Install a Security Plugin: Choose a comprehensive security plugin such as Wordfence and configure its settings.
- Implement Caching: Install a caching plugin and configure it according to your site’s needs.
- Optimize Images and Minify Files: Use recommended plugins to optimize media and minify CSS/JS files.
- Set Up Monitoring Tools: Integrate monitoring tools to track uptime and performance metrics.
Following this checklist will help ensure that you are maximizing both security and performance for your clients, ultimately leading to their satisfaction and your agency’s success.
Questions and Answers
What are the best practices for securing WordPress?
Best practices include keeping WordPress core, themes, and plugins updated, using strong passwords, implementing two-factor authentication, and conducting regular security audits. Additionally, using security plugins can help automate many of these tasks.
How can performance affect SEO and user experience?
A slow-loading website can lead to higher bounce rates and lower rankings in search engine results. Google considers site speed as a ranking factor, making it crucial for agencies to optimize site performance for both SEO and user experience.
What tools can I use to monitor WordPress security?
Tools such as WPScan, Wordfence, and Sucuri can help monitor security vulnerabilities. Additionally, using uptime monitoring tools like Uptime Robot ensures that your site remains accessible and secure.
What are the signs of a compromised WordPress site?
Signs include unexpected changes to website content, unfamiliar users in the admin panel, slow performance, and security warnings from your hosting provider. Regular monitoring can help detect these issues early on.
How often should I perform security audits on WordPress sites?
It is recommended to perform security audits at least quarterly. However, for high-traffic sites or those handling sensitive information, monthly audits may be necessary to ensure robust security.
Conclusion
Maximizing WordPress security and performance is not just a technical necessity; it is a strategic advantage that marketing agencies can leverage to build client trust and ensure success. By implementing the expert development solutions outlined in this article, junior WordPress developers can significantly enhance their skill set and deliver exceptional value to their clients. As you continue to refine your approach to WordPress development, remember that a secure and fast website is the foundation of a successful online presence.
If you’re looking for an expert WordPress developer to help elevate your projects, I invite you to contact me. With a deep understanding of WordPress security and performance optimization, I can assist you in delivering outstanding results that will ensure your clients’ success.